  • Entrance Exam


    The HSPT will be offered on the Xaverian campus on Saturday, November 18 and Saturday, December 2. We accept any of the following entrance exams for admission to grade 9: 

    High School Placement Test (HSPT)
    Secondary School Admissions Test (SSAT)
    Independent School Entrance Exam (ISEE)

    If you are taking an exam at another testing location, please use the following codes to send your scores to Xaverian:

    HSPT school code: 38
    SSAT school code: 8350
    ISEE school code: 570431

  • Financial Aid


    All families are welcome to apply for need-based financial aid before the January 16 deadline. We are committed to providing a Xaverian education to every qualified young man, regardless of financial need. 

    Last year, 54% of all Xaverian families received tuition assistance grants. The average annual cost for families receiving need-based financial aid is $14,277. In total, we awarded over $6 million in financial aid and academic scholarships. For more information, please visit our tuition assistance page.
  • Non-Discrimination Policy

     
    Xaverian Brothers High School admits students of any race, color, national and ethnic origin, religion, or creed to all the rights, privileges, programs and activities generally accorded or made available to students at the School. It does not discriminate on the basis of race, color, national and ethnic origin, religion or creed in the administration of its education policies, scholarship and financial aid programs and athletic and other school-administered programs.
